lechu2375

Untitled

Sep 10th, 2018
23
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 1.13 KB | None | 0 0
  1. AddCSLuaFile( "cl_init.lua" )
  2. AddCSLuaFile( "shared.lua" )  
  3. include("shared.lua")
  4.  
  5. osadzeni_restricted = {
  6.     "TEAM_OSADZONY",
  7.     "TEAM_OSADZONY1",
  8.     "TEAM_OSADZONY2",
  9.     "TEAM_OSADZONY3",
  10.     "TEAM_OSADZONY4",
  11.     "TEAM_OSADZONY5",
  12. }
  13.  
  14. function ENT:Initialize()
  15.     self:SetModel("models/props_vehicles/car001a_hatchback.mdl")
  16.     self:PhysicsInit( SOLID_VPHYSICS )
  17.     self:SetMoveType( MOVETYPE_VPHYSICS )  
  18.     self:SetSolid( SOLID_VPHYSICS )        
  19.  
  20.        local phys = self:GetPhysicsObject()
  21.     if phys:IsValid() then
  22.         phys:Wake()
  23.     end
  24. end
  25. function ENT:Use(ply, caller)
  26.    local random = math.random(1,2)
  27.    local ids = ply:Team()
  28.    local praca = team.GetName(ids)
  29.     if random == 1 and table.HasValue(osadzeni_restricted,ids) and (ply:GetPData( "przebranie", 0 )==0) then
  30.             ply:changeTeam("TEAM_REBEL", false, false)
  31.             ply:SetPData( "przebranie", 1 )
  32.         else
  33.             ply:changeTeam("TEAM_CYWIL", false, false)
  34.             ply:SetPData( "przebranie", 1 )
  35.     end
  36. end
  37. function ENT:Think()
  38. end
  39.  
  40.  
  41. hook.Add("PlayerDeath",wywalka,function()
  42.     if (ply:GetPData( "przebranie", 0 )==1) then
  43.         ply:SetPData( "przebranie", 0 )
  44.     end
  45. end )
Add Comment
Please, Sign In to add comment